gpt4 book ai didi

php - flexigrid 示例从 mysql 返回数据

转载 作者:行者123 更新时间:2023-11-29 07:07:37 25 4
gpt4 key购买 nike

我确定可以做到,我只需要看一些例子。我想使用 flexigrid 来显示存储在 mysql 中的大量数据集。我精通 php,但对 jquery 和 json 不熟悉。

任何人都可以指出正确的方向或提供一个很好的例子吗?我需要了解如何将数据返回到 flexigrid json。

谢谢

Great Tutorial on this topic

最佳答案

这只是返回数据库结果的部分代码,您可以使用 flexigrid jquery 代码调用您的页面

        while ($row = mysql_fetch_assoc($results)) {
$data['rows'][] = array(
'id' => $row['pf_id'],
'cell' => array(
$row['cat_code'],
$row['cat_title'],
$row['cat_link'] = "<a href=\"catagory_edit.php?cat_id=".$row['cat_id']."\">Edit</a> | <a href=\"catagory_to_family_association.php?cat_id=".$row['cat_id']."\">Associate Familys</a> | <a href=\"category_child_order.php?cat_id=".$row['cat_id']."\">Order Children</a>")); }
echo json_encode($data);

使用flexigrid jquery代码调用页面

$("#flex1").flexigrid({
url: 'category_main_json.php',
dataType: 'json',
colModel : [
{display: 'Code', name : 'cat_code', width : 70, sortable : true, align: 'left'},
{display: 'Name', name : 'cat_title', width : 550, sortable : true, align: 'left'},
{display: 'Action', name : 'cat_link', width : 205, sortable : true, align: 'left'},
],
buttons : [
{name: 'Add New Category', bclass: 'add', onpress : test},
{separator: true}
],
searchitems : [
{display: 'Code', name : 'cat_code'},
{display: 'Name', name : 'cat_title', isdefault: true}
],
sortname: "cat_code",
sortorder: "asc",
usepager: true,
useRp: true,
rp: 50,
showTableToggleBtn: false,
resizable: false,
width: 880,
height: 450,
singleSelect: true,
showTableToggleBtn: false

}
);

关于php - flexigrid 示例从 mysql 返回数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6386975/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com